The Itinerary Breakdown

Early Start and Pickup

The day kicks off at 7:30 am with a pickup from your hotel or apartment, or directly from Zadar Cruise Port if you’re arriving by ship. This early start is key to beating the crowds at Plitvice and making the most of the day. The comfortable, air-conditioned vehicle ensures you travel in style and avoid the hassle of navigating yourself.

The Journey to the Park

While the transfer takes about two hours, this drive is often highlighted as a pleasant part of the experience. Reviewers like Karen and Lisa appreciated the friendly, easygoing nature of guides like Terezija, who made the drive engaging with stories and insights about Croatia. It’s a good opportunity to relax and prepare for the awe-inspiring scenery ahead.

Exploring the Park

Once inside, the 4-hour guided tour covers the main highlights of Plitvice Lakes. The itinerary includes both Upper and Lower Lakes, with scenic walks across wooden pathways that weave through the waterfalls, lush greenery, and crystal-clear waters. You’ll enjoy a boat ride across the lakes, providing tranquil views and a different perspective of the waterfalls — a favorite feature among reviewers like Gaye and Marianne.

The Big Waterfall is a standout, often described as breathtaking. As Ken_L notes, the park’s natural beauty is “iconic,” and the guide’s commentary adds context and stories that bring the landscape alive.

Lunch and Refreshments

Included in the package is a lunch buffet featuring a sandwich, apple, pastry, juice, and water. Several travelers, including Judy_P and Jaye_R, found the lunch to be simple but adequate, especially considering the short 30-minute break to eat and rest. Interestingly, some reviewers wished for longer or more flexible lunch options, or better ways to carry their food—like a backpack—since the lunch spot was a bit of a walk from the bus.

Considerations for Travelers

Some reviewers, like sara_P, noted the day’s pace can be hurried, and the walking can be strenuous—up to five miles over uneven terrain. Good footwear is recommended, and people with mobility concerns should consider this. Also, a couple of reviews mention delays or late arrivals, which underscores the importance of punctuality and flexibility.
